Number of new COVID-19 cases in Ukraine continues to grow. Over the past day another 525 people were infected and 357 recovered, the Center for Public Health reports.

The number of people infected since the start of the pandemic totals 28,381. Over the past day another 23 people died from the virus.

Most new cases of the disease were registered in Volyn (101), Lviv (78), Kyiv (58) and Zhytomyr (38) regions. No new cases of COVID-19 were recorded in Kirovohrad, Mykolaiv, Sumy, Kherson and Luhansk regions.

At the same time, as of the morning of June 10, 7,323,918 cases of coronavirus infection were registered globally. The Covid-19 death toll reached 417,733 people, according to Worldometers.

Ukraine partially lifted quarantine restrictions on regular flights, domestic flights have been operating since June 5, and international planned to be launched after the 15th of June. From June 11, Ukraine introduced the next stage of quarantine weakening.
